The Arbor Inn Motel is located North of Boston on historic and scenic route 1A. Centrally located amongst the historic towns of Gloucester, Rockport, Salem, Newburyport, Essex and Rowley. For history buffs, Ipswich has more 17th century buildings than any other place in America. Over 40 homes still used today were built before 1725. There are many year-round events in Ipswich and the surrounding towns including Olde Ipswich Days arts & crafts festival in July, eclectic musical offerings from symphonies to coffee-houses, and many celebrations. Area restaurants offer both casual and formal dining, canoeing, hiking, beaches, horseback riding, antique hunting, golf and great shopping.
